What sets Hervey Bay apart from other whale-watching locations is its specific location and environment. Secured by the calm waters developed by Fraser Island (K'gari), it provides a natural shelter for migrating humpback whales. Yearly, between July and November, hundreds of these magnificent whales make their way to Hervey Bay during their impressive migration along Australia's east coastline.

Hervey Bay stands out for being a relaxing place for humpback whales, unlike various other regions where they are commonly seen in motion. In Hervey Bay, the whales pause to unwind, connect and care for their young. This allows tourists to observe special occasions, such as mother whales leading their calves on breaching strategies and engaging in spirited behaviors like tail slapping and fin shaking.
